I recently got a 16gb i8510 and have been struggling with a problem where the phone will not recognise contacts stored in the phone when calls or sms messages are received.
After some testing, I've found that a contact is only recognised if the number is EXACTLY the same as what's against the contact. The problem is that numbers for incoming mobile calls are received differently to the numbers for incoming sms messages, which include the country code.
For example: I have a contact in the phone with the mobile number 0412 345 678.
When an incoming call is received, the number is displayed as 0412345678. The phone recognises the contact and displays the name.
When an sms is received, the number is displayed with the country code +61412345678. The phone does not recognise the contact and only displays the phone number.
I've tried the reverse of this with the contact including the country code. In this scenario, the contact is recognised when an sms is received but not when a call is received.
This happens with contacts synced over from outlook 2003 (also scrubbed any duplicates) as well as contacts created on the phone itself, so it doesn't seem to be sync/outlook problem.
I've also tried to update firmware via PC Studio 7, but the application tells me that the phone is up to date.
